A variation of a triathlon competition has a contestant swimming from a point, A, on one shore of a lake, to a point C on the opposite parallel shore, then running to the finish, B, further along the
lakeshore. The lake is 4km wide and the finish line is 10km down the lake. If a contestant can swim at
2km/h and run at 10km/h, determine the point C that will minimize the total time for the race.
